State Records Committee Appeal Hearing Procedures Amended

The Utah State Records Committee is amending its appeal hearing procedures to reflect legislative changes, expedite hearings, and accommodate electronic or telephonic participation.

The Bottom Line

The amended rule shortens the time for parties' testimony, requires third-party participants to notify the Executive Secretary, allows electronic or telephonic participation, and modifies procedures for postponing hearings and distributing decisions.

Key Numbers

  • Testimony of parties is shortened from 30 to 20 minutes.
  • Third party presentations are limited to five minutes.
  • Recordings of meetings are posted on the Public Notice Website within three days of the meeting.

Source Verification

The State Records Committee decides on the rule, authorized by Subsection 63G-2-502(2)(a), Section 63G-3-402, Subsection 63G-3-601(3), and Article IV of Utah statutes, as published in DAR File No. 38640.

  • "Changes in the rules reflect legislative changes creating the Public Notice Website and the Government Records Ombudsman position. Proposed changes in this rule are to expedite hearings and to accommodate parties who may be participating in a hearing electronically or telephonically."
    Purpose of the rule or reason
  • "Changes include shortening the time for testimony of the parties from thirty to twenty minutes. third party participants shall notify the Executive Secretary prior to a hearing and are limited to five minutes. Parties may participate electronically or telephonically."
    Summary of the rule or change
  • "Recordings of meetings are posted on the Public Notice Website within three days of the meeting. Written minutes shall be made available one week prior to the scheduled meeting and shall be marked as "Draft". Minutes shall be amended and/or approved with individual votes recorded in the minutes. Approved written minutes shall be made available on the Public Notice Website."
